Manufactured in Heng Shui ZhengXuan Industrial Zone, AnPing, HengShui, HeBei, China, our 3d fence uses low-carbon steel wire (Q195/Q235). Resistance-welded intersections keep panels square; then a 3D press forms the signature V-beams to boost rigidity without adding weight.
| Parameter | Typical Spec (≈ / around) |
|---|---|
| Panel height | 1.2–2.4 m (custom up to 3.0 m) |
| Panel width | 2.0–2.5 m |
| Mesh aperture | 50×200 mm (≈ 2×8 in) |
| Wire diameter | 3.5–5.0 mm |
| Posts | 60×60 or 80×60 mm, hot-dip or pre-galv + powder |
| Coating | Zinc (EN 10244-2) + polyester powder 60–80 μm (ISO 12944 guidance) |
| Service life | ≈ 10–25 years (real-world use may vary by environment) |

Panels and coatings are validated against widely recognized methods: zinc class to EN 10244-2, adhesion per ASTM D3359, and salt spray per ASTM B117. Coating design follows ISO 12944 guidance for C2–C4 environments; hot-dip galvanizing where specified follows ISO 1461.
